Controllers glitch, go off and haywire randomly and very frequently. Some apps have stopped launching from this update. My Quest 3 is basically unusable.

Yes, my headset seemed to update again and it was solved. The controller tracking is still less reliable in passthrough especially at night, I'm assuming it relies more on the camera than the IR lights from v68.
In summary or again, bugginess fixed. But in a very specific situation passthrough + dim room controller still tends to lose tracking.

First of all, can we just ask you remove any 3rd party accessories you may have attached. in addition, what do the LED lights display on the controller? Can we also ask that you try changing the batteries to ones with a full charge.
